Emerging oral atypical antipsychotics to compete in increasingly crowded schizophrenia drug market

Published on February 24, 2010 at 4:47 AM · No Comments

Decision Resources, one of the world's leading research and advisory firms for pharmaceutical and healthcare issues, finds that, in the world's major pharmaceutical markets, emerging oral atypical antipsychotics will compete against each other and against established drugs for the same niche patient population in the treatment of schizophrenia.
